New PCCF fund provides COVID relief

Tuesday, January 26, 2021
With the newly-established Buzzi Unicem USA COVID Relief Fund now in place, the Putnam County Community Foundation and Buzzi make the first grant from the fund, $5,000 to Family Support Services of West Central Indiana. Present for the donation are Dean Gambill of PCCF, Tim Menke of Buzzi Unicem, Elizabeth Butts and Jena Welker of Family Support Services, Steve Welker of Buzzi Unicem and Sheri Nield of Family Support Services.
Courtesy photo

The Putnam County Community Foundation has announced one of its newest funds, the Buzzi Unicem USA Covid Relief Fund.

This fund was established by Buzzi Unicem USA to assist in alleviating the burdens COVID-19 has created within Putnam County.

“We are honored to partner with Buzzi and work alongside Tim Menke from the Greencastle plant,” PCCF Community Development Director Dean Gambill said. “Their fund will allow the Community Foundation to continue our efforts to meet the emerging needs created by COVID-19.”

The fund recently awarded a $5,000 grant to Family Support Services of West Central Indiana for its Victim and Family Support Fund. The funding will allow Family Support Services to provide direct assistance to clients when they need it the most.

“We could not be more thankful for the support and generosity of the Foundation and Buzzi Unicem during this time.” Family Support Services Executive Director Scott Monnett said. “This award will help us provide support to victims and families we serve every day through our Domestic Violence and Sexual Assault Victim Services, Healthy Families and Recovery Coalition efforts. With the loss of fundraising events in 2020 due to COVID our resources available to provide support were limited. This gift provides a strong foundation for us to continue meeting the immediate needs of our clients when they are in crisis.”

The Putnam County Community Foundation (PCCF) works alongside individuals, businesses, and nonprofit organizations to build a stronger Putnam County. PCCF is home to more than 300 charitable funds and has awarded more than $16 million in grants and scholarships since its founding in 1985.
